Flamengo takes the field this Wednesday (21) to face Vasco, starting at 9:30 PM (Brasília time), at Maracanã. During the pre-match, coach Filipe Luís explained the absences of midfielders Jorginho and Arrascaeta from the squad for the derby.
“Jorginho had a tooth pulled, his wisdom tooth, and Arrascaeta is not fit to play,” said coach Filipe Luís. The Flamengo coach commented on the absences in an interview with GETV, on YouTube.
Thus, without Arrascaeta and Jorginho, Filipe Luís, Flamengo goes into the derby against Vasco with the main squad. With that, the red-and-black team will play their first match of the season, since the under-20s had been playing in the Campeonato Carioca. The coach commented on the clash.
— It’s always challenging to play a derby. These are very demanding matches, especially against Fernando Diniz’s teams, which always make things very complicated and push you to your limits. The players, without a doubt, will need to make a big effort to win, because we are here, at Maracanã, in front of our fans. We want to play a great match —, concluded the Flamengo coach.
Thus, without Arrascaeta and Jorginho, Flamengo faces Vasco this Wednesday (21), at 9:30 PM (Brasília time), at Maracanã, in a match valid for the third round of the Campeonato Carioca. Thus, Coluna do Fla brings you all the information about the match.
